Structural basis for alternative 3′ splice site selection in the human spliceosome active center
2026-08-06
Abstract excerpt
Accurate alternative splicing requires discrimination between adjacent 3′ splice sites (3′-ss) during catalysis and is disrupted by pathogenic AG-gain mutations that create competing 3′-ss. Here, we present cryo-EM structures of human spliceosomes assembled on native-sequence pre-mRNAs, revealing how the catalytic core controls alternative 3′-ss selection.
